    Form ADV-E.

    [OMB Control No. 3235-0361, SEC File No. 270-318]

    Notice is hereby given that, pursuant to the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995 (44 U.S.C. 3501 et seq.), the Securities and Exchange Commission (the “Commission”) is soliciting comments on the collection of information summarized below. The Commission plans to submit this existing collection of information to the Office of Management and Budget for extension and approval.

    Form ADV-E (17 CFR 279.8) is the cover sheet for certificates of accounting filed pursuant to rule 206(4)-2 under the Investment Advisers Act of 1940 (17 CFR 275.206(4)-2). The rule further requires that the public accountant file with the Commission a Form ADV-E and accompanying statement within four business days of the resignation, dismissal, removal or other termination of its engagement. Respondents each spend approximately three minutes, annually, complying with the requirements of the form.

    The estimate of burden hours set forth above is made solely for the purposes of the Paperwork Reduction Act and is not derived from a comprehensive or even representative survey or study of the cost of Commission rules and forms.
